The Betts Spin 1/16 Value Pack Split Tail in Black/Yellow Stripe is a hand-poured jig designed to catch bass, crappie, and bluegill. This lure features a split tail design paired with a rotating blade that's balanced to work at a slow, deliberate pace—exactly what panfish and bass want on the strike. The black and yellow stripe pattern is a proven color combo that stands out in both clear and stained water, and the hand-painted details add a custom touch that separates these from mass-produced alternatives. What fish will the Betts Spin 1/16 catch?
This lure is deadly for bass, crappie, and bluegill. The 1/16 oz. weight and action make it especially effective for panfish, though bass will readily strike it in shallow or light-cover situations.

How does the rotating blade work?
The blade is balanced and finished to rotate at a slow, deliberate speed as the jig falls or is retrieved. This rotation creates flash and vibration that attract fish and trigger strikes.
